diff --git a/4chan_x.user.js b/4chan_x.user.js index 8989c0092..e73f5eb0f 100644 --- a/4chan_x.user.js +++ b/4chan_x.user.js @@ -2002,16 +2002,8 @@ scrollBG: function() { return updater.scrollBG = this.checked ? function() { return true; - } : d.visibilityState ? function() { - return !d.hidden; - } : d.oVisibilityState ? function() { - return !d.oHidden; - } : d.mozVisibilityState ? function() { - return !d.mozHidden; - } : d.webkitVisibilityState ? function() { - return !d.webkitHidden; } : function() { - return true; + return !(d.hidden || d.oHidden || d.mozHidden || d.webkitHidden); }; }, update: function() { diff --git a/script.coffee b/script.coffee index 379f5b55f..8f1e9a8f4 100644 --- a/script.coffee +++ b/script.coffee @@ -1612,16 +1612,7 @@ updater = if @checked -> true else - if d.visibilityState - -> !d.hidden - else if d.oVisibilityState - -> !d.oHidden - else if d.mozVisibilityState - -> !d.mozHidden - else if d.webkitVisibilityState - -> !d.webkitHidden - else - -> true + -> !(d.hidden or d.oHidden or d.mozHidden or d.webkitHidden) update: -> if @status is 404 updater.timer.textContent = ''